Who was the primary black NFL quarter-back? That is an extremely exciting question and also the reaction appears to count significantly on who you check with. You can hear names like Briscoe and Harris, Williams and Thrower but were any of them genuinely the very first black QB? Let's do some investigate.
Some are confident that the right remedy may be the one particular and only Willie Thrower. He performed with the Chicago bears in mid Oct of 1953. He under no circumstances appeared in Yet another match and It will be fifteen decades right before A further African-American would have a snap in a pro activity. But is this Traditionally correct? Other people Believe it absolutely was a person named Joe Guilliam, known as Jefferson Street Joe not until eventually the early 70s. Joe even provides a Website devoted to him with this particular honor and each are often credited Together with the title of the initial black quarter again. But had there really been nobody in advance of these players?
As a consequence of racial attitudes of enough time evidently when black players had been permitted to Participate in not several got starting up positions, and when every one of the prior described players do have their roles from the heritage of black quarter backs, and it can be correct to declare that Briscoe was the very first to start out a match. He performed for to be a QB for your Denver Broncos in 1968. Time traces and history tell us that it wouldn't be right until 1974 for just a black participant to begin a playoff video game. His title was James Harris and he performed for The l. a. Rams. It will be fourteen many years right before Doug Williams could well be the very first to start out and acquire a championship to the Washington Redskins in 1988.
What is the best and many precise response? The right response must be none of the earlier mentioned with the proper reaction dating back again A great deal further more than popular misconception.
In fact, Fritz Pollard is the proper reaction. He performed quarterback way again during the early 20s New York Giants jerseys for your workforce often known as the Hammond Pros. Frederick Douglass "Fritz" Pollard was born in 1894 in Rogers Park, Ill., a Chicago Suburb. He was certainly one of eight small children. Pollard graduated from Lane high School in Chicago the place he ran track and afterwards went on to Perform faculty football at Brown University. In 1915 being a freshman, he led Brown to your Rose Bowl vs. Washington Condition. He was also the main African American to Enjoy in a very Rose Bowl. Amongst other accomplishments within the spring of 1916, he established a entire world document in small hurdles to the Brown College monitor workforce, qualifying with the Olympic staff. Also in 1916 he led Brown to an eight-one document with 12 touchdowns. He was the initial African American Click here for info head coach from the NFL. He also organized the 1st inter-racial all-star activity in Chicago to showcase African American players. "Frtiz" Pollard died in 1986 with the age of 92.
